Basically here's how it works...

The program connects up to a central server and downloads a scenario to your PC that has to be computed. It then disconnects and spends the next few days using your unused cpu cycles to compute the resolution locally. When it has completed the computations it connects up to the server, sends the results and downloads another scenario.

I have my screen saver set to come on after about 15 minutes or so. So anytime I am active on my PC the program is dorment. When I am not using the computer for anything else, its unused cycles are put to good use.
